Question: You are the Chief Information Officer for a local hospital. Recently, your hospital has been required to update their policies to protect the information of the patients at the facility. These policies have been scrutinized in the community. Some community members think the new policies are preventing insurance providers from paying claims and for patients to get the information they need. You will write letter to the editor of your local newspaper to explain why patient privacy, security and personal health records must be protected.
Once you have completed all the readings for the week, conduct a search for information on security, privacy and access to records. Investigate some previous examples of patients' information being misused to support your case.
The letter begins with an overview of the process that has changed.Includes a detailed explanation of the role of the senior level informaticist in privacy, security, access to and maintenance of personal health records (PHRs), requirements and legalities.Includes information on how the patient's rights are being protected.Includes examples of security breaches to illustrate the need for privacy policies.Ends with a conclusion about how the privacy policy will be put to work in the real world.
